Voltage Quality in Electrical Power Systems:
Problems of voltage quality are becoming increasingly important with the growth in power electronics and the high-sensitivity of electronic equipment. Translated and updated from the German original published by VDE-Verlag, this volume details the theoretical background to low-voltage conducted disturbances in relation to voltage quality. The text describes solutions to practical application problems, including measurement, assessment and countermeasures, set in the context of European standards.
